Deliveroo Australia will not be bringing foods to shoppers. The meals supply provider has long gone into voluntary management and can stop operations right away.

KordaMentha has been officially appointed as the method’s administrator.

Deliveroo, an organization with its headquarters in Melbourne and an inventory at the London Inventory Trade, joined the meals supply sector in Australia in 2015 and has since entered the grocery supply marketplace with companions BP and EzyMart.

Consumers are supplied with an error message that reads “there’s an issue” and urges them to go back to the app later. The website online states that Deliveroo is not available in Australia. The commentary reads: “Deliveroo has taken the tricky resolution to depart Australia. We have now been proud to convey such a lot of folks superb foods from Australia’s nice eating places over time. We need to thank everybody we’ve got labored with.”

In line with native media assets, the UK-based industry knowledgeable its Australian shoppers by way of electronic mail on Wednesday afternoon that they’d not be capable of make purchases in the course of the website online. 

“This has been a troublesome resolution to make. We have now loved serving you the fantastic meals that Australia is understood for, running with hundreds of sensible eating places and riders,” the e-mail mentioned. 

Deliveroo’s losses soared as income expansion slowed greatly within the first part of 2022, as call for for web takeaway used to be decreased by way of the removing of pandemic restrictions and an build up in the price of residing.

Intense pageant

The newest player within the Australian meals supply sport, which already contains Uber Eats and Menulog, is the USA powerhouse DoorDash. Deliveroo claimed in a commentary that there have been 4 world competition in Australia and that it lacked “a huge base of robust native positions.”

In line with analysts, emerging inflation and rates of interest have brought about mission capitalists to grow to be a lot more wary with their cash. In earlier years, they’ve been ready to speculate billions of bucks in “disruptive virtual darlings” within the hopes that they might someday flip a benefit.

Previous, an Australian startup providing on-line grocery supply, Voly, hastily went down. Beginning and working a industry like house supply is costly. Additionally they want a community of warehouses shut sufficient to shoppers to make supply, and the faster the deliveries are anticipated to be, the extra warehouses are wanted.

A string of departures

The U.Ok. meals supply corporate mentioned in August that it’s consulting on plans to go out the Netherlands, marking its 3rd departure from a key EU nation. Because of the chance of significantly stricter gig financial system regulation within the Eu Union, the corporate already withdrew from Spain in 2018 and Germany in 2019. 

Deliveroo, like many different gig financial system enterprises working in Australia, has not too long ago been entangled in prison battles surrounding staff’ rights.

In Would possibly 2021, the corporate misplaced a Honest Paintings Fee criticism when the fee determined that firing a rider for being too gradual all through the height of the Covid-19 outbreak used to be “harsh, unjust, and beside the point.” The FWC made up our minds that Deliveroo wrongfully terminated a long-term supply driving force. The FWCs dominated that supply drivers for meals supply firms are staff quite than unbiased contractors.
